dc.description.abstract | MgCl2/THF/TiCl4 (TT-0) were thermally pretreated at 80 degrees C for 5 min (TT-1) and 60 min (TT-2), and at 108 degrees C for 5 min (TT-3) and 60 min (TT-4). These thermally pretreated catalysts showed comonomer enhancement effects in the ethylene-1-hexene copolymerization, while TT-0 catalyst did not. Comonomer enhancement effect of thermally pretreated catalysts could come from the generation of new active sites and change of its nature after heat treatment. l-Hexene content in copolymer obtained with TT-1 was higher than those of TT-4 and TT-0. The morphology of homopolyethylene (PE) obtained with TT-1, 2, 3, and 4 was more regular and homogeneous than that of TT-0. This result could be due to the generation of active sites and change of its nature after thermal treatment of bimetallic catalyst. (C) 1997 John Wiley & Sons, Inc. | - |
